As Chair of Senate Natural Resources and Water Committee, Senator Min got negative points because a water rights bill took significant amendments in his committee. His committee was also responsible for stopping 3 other pro-environment bills: one on groundwater, another bill on modernizing water rights, and a bill that would have put more accountability and transparency on carbon offsets..

How We Calculated the Weighted Score

100% environmental votes/authorship

Extra Credit:

-1%
for amendments weakening pro-environmental bills
-2%
for blocking pro-environmental bills
-1%
for passing anti-environmental bills
+1%
for blocking anti-environmental bills
